Strong grading candidate — 9.0× premium in PSA 10

A PSA 10 Communion in the Force [Blue Refractor] #48 sells for $69.99 against $7.75 raw: a $62.24 spread, 9.0× the ungraded price. A PSA 9 ($15.25) only about breaks even after fees, so the case rests on gemming.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.

Break-even by outcome and fee

Communion in the Force [Blue Refractor] #48: net result of grading versus selling raw, by outcome and fee tier
If it comes back…Sells forEconomy / bulk (~$25.00)Standard (~$50.00)Express (~$150)
Gem — PSA 10$69.99+$37.24+$12.24−$87.76
PSA 9$15.25−$17.50−$42.50−$143

Net = sale price − $7.75 raw value − fee. Fee tiers are illustrative; plug your grader's current price into the calculator below.

Which grader pays the most — and what a 10 takes

All centering standards
Communion in the Force [Blue Refractor] #48: top-grade value by grading company with centering tolerance
Grader10 sells forvs bestFront centering for a 10Back
BGS 10$91.00best55/4570/30
PSA 10$69.99−$21.0155/4575/25
CGC 10$42.00−$49.0055/4575/25
SGC 10$42.00−$49.0055/4575/25

Tolerances are each company's published centering standard for its top grade; surface, corners and edges must also be clean. Centering is the one you can measure yourself before you pay.
